## Kia Sedona 2008: A Spacious and Reliable Family Minivan

The 2008 Kia Sedona is a second-generation minivan that embodies the brand's commitment to providing spacious and affordable family transportation. This model marked a significant leap forward from its predecessor, boasting a refined exterior design with sharper lines and a more modern aesthetic. The interior, while still prioritizing practicality, offered a more comfortable and upscale feel, featuring a dual-zone climate control system, a power driver's seat, and optional leather upholstery. Under the hood, the Sedona was powered by a 3.8-liter V6 engine producing a respectable 248 horsepower, paired with a smooth-shifting 5-speed automatic transmission. The Sedona's impressive cargo capacity (144 cubic feet with the seats folded) and versatile seating configurations made it an ideal choice for families on the go, while its safety features, including standard anti-lock brakes and electronic stability control, ensured peace of mind for parents.

Despite its practicality and comfort, the 2008 Sedona was not without its drawbacks. While its fuel economy was decent for a minivan, it lagged behind some competitors. Additionally, some owners reported issues with the transmission and suspension, particularly with early models. Nevertheless, the Sedona's strong points, such as its spacious interior, well-equipped features, and competitive price, made it a popular choice for those seeking a reliable and affordable family minivan. The 2008 Sedona represents a transitional period for Kia, showcasing the brand's growing maturity and commitment to building quality vehicles. While it might not stand out in terms of innovative features or cutting-edge technology, the Sedona's practicality, comfort, and reliability make it a worthy contender in the minivan segment, particularly for budget-conscious families.
